arm64: barrier: Use '__unqual_scalar_typeof' for acquire/release macros

Passing volatile-qualified pointers to the arm64 implementations of the
load-acquire/store-release macros results in a re-load from the stack
and a bunch of associated stack-protector churn due to the temporary
result variable inheriting the volatile semantics thanks to the use of
'typeof()'.

Define these temporary variables using 'unqual_scalar_typeof' to drop
the volatile qualifier in the case that they are scalar types.

diff --git a/arch/arm64/include/asm/barrier.h b/arch/arm64/include/asm/barrier.h
index 7d9cc5e..fb4c275 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/include/asm/barrier.h
+++ b/arch/arm64/include/asm/barrier.h
@@ -76,8 +76,8 @@ static inline unsigned long array_index_mask_nospec(unsigned long idx,
 #define __smp_store_release(p, v)					\
 do {									\
 	typeof(p) __p = (p);						\
-	union { typeof(*p) __val; char __c[1]; } __u =			\
-		{ .__val = (__force typeof(*p)) (v) };			\
+	union { __unqual_scalar_typeof(*p) __val; char __c[1]; } __u =	\
+		{ .__val = (__force __unqual_scalar_typeof(*p)) (v) };	\
 	compiletime_assert_atomic_type(*p);				\
 	kasan_check_write(__p, sizeof(*p));				\
 	switch (sizeof(*p)) {						\
@@ -110,7 +110,7 @@ do {									\
 
 #define __smp_load_acquire(p)						\
 ({									\
-	union { typeof(*p) __val; char __c[1]; } __u;			\
+	union { __unqual_scalar_typeof(*p) __val; char __c[1]; } __u;	\
 	typeof(p) __p = (p);						\
 	compiletime_assert_atomic_type(*p);				\
 	kasan_check_read(__p, sizeof(*p));				\
@@ -136,33 +136,33 @@ do {									\
 			: "Q" (*__p) : "memory");			\
 		break;							\
 	}								\
-	__u.__val;							\
+	(typeof(*p))__u.__val;						\
 })
 
 #define smp_cond_load_relaxed(ptr, cond_expr)				\
 ({									\
 	typeof(ptr) __PTR = (ptr);					\
-	typeof(*ptr) VAL;						\
+	__unqual_scalar_typeof(*ptr) VAL;				\
 	for (;;) {							\
 		VAL = READ_ONCE(*__PTR);				\
 		if (cond_expr)						\
 			break;						\
 		__cmpwait_relaxed(__PTR, VAL);				\
 	}								\
-	VAL;								\
+	(typeof(*ptr))VAL;						\
 })
 
 #define smp_cond_load_acquire(ptr, cond_expr)				\
 ({									\
 	typeof(ptr) __PTR = (ptr);					\
-	typeof(*ptr) VAL;						\
+	__unqual_scalar_typeof(*ptr) VAL;				\
 	for (;;) {							\
 		VAL = smp_load_acquire(__PTR);				\
 		if (cond_expr)						\
 			break;						\
 		__cmpwait_relaxed(__PTR, VAL);				\
 	}								\
-	VAL;								\
+	(typeof(*ptr))VAL;						\
 })
